Spade is used as a family name or surname in Germany. It is 5 characters long in length.
Is variant of Speed. Probably have reference to the swiftness of the original bearers.
Family name Spade is a form of Spatz. One with some characteristic of a little sparrow.

Despite the fact that the number of Spade bearers increased by 6.78 per cent in 2010 US census to 2536 since 2000, the surname slipped by 206 spots and ranked at 12264. The last name was found in around 9 per million population. Please refer to following table for race and ethnicity.
Race | 2010 | 2000 |
---|---|---|
White | 90.93 | 92.59 |
Black | 3.9 | 2.74 |
Others | 1.85 | 1.77 |
Hispanic or Latino | 1.81 | 1.22 |
American Indian and Alaska Native | 1.1 | 1.39 |
Asian and Native Hawaiian & Other Pacific Islander | 0.39 | 0.29 |
